Where to Go

Stein am Rhein is a beautiful town with many things to see and do. Some of the most popular attractions include:

  • The Old Town: The Old Town is a UNESCO World Heritage Site and is full of charming cobblestone streets, colorful houses, and historic buildings.
  • The Rheinbrücke: The Rheinbrücke is a wooden bridge that spans the Rhine River. It is one of the most iconic landmarks in Stein am Rhein.
  • The Klostermuseum: The Klostermuseum is a museum that tells the story of the Benedictine monastery that was once located in Stein am Rhein.
